Create Pc Video games – Get Began on Creating Your Personal Digital Worlds
Ive at all times liked video video games, ever since I first performed them on a pals pc within the afternoon after elementary college. Theres one thing nearly magical about the truth that we will transfer photographs round and work together with digital worlds, a dwelling fantasy introduced for us to work together with nevertheless we please. Ive additionally at all times wished to make video games myself however, till just lately, didnt have the technical data to take action. Now, Im a second yr software program engineering pupil, so if I werent capable of code a sport with out too many dramas thered be one thing drastically unsuitable. However what in regards to the frequent individual: the individual for whom the time period reminiscence leak conjures up photographs of their grandfather, pipeline is the place the water flows, and blitting is exceptional? Nicely, everybody can get in on the sport creation course of, and also you dont even have to be taught actual programming to take action.
So the place do video games begin? With an thought. Video games, like all fiction, require an thought to achieve success. Certain, in the identical means you may simply sit down and write a narrative with out foresight, you may bounce on in and slap a sport collectively. Nonetheless, except you get ridiculously fortunate, one of the best works are normally those which were effectively thought out beforehand.
There are two strategies of planning a mission. You can begin from a recognized technological standpoint and construct your mission on prime of that or you may simply go for the design, add as many options and concepts as you want, after which take away those which you couldt use if youve selected the know-how youre going to implement the sport with. Basically, the second kind might be one of the best one to go together with when designing video games. Once youre first beginning out nevertheless, the primary choice will prevent many complications.
So, for a primary sport youre going to need a fairly easy thought. Dont get me unsuitable, crazy-go-nuts sport concepts are implausible, and there needs to be extra of them on the market, however youre not going to have the ability to create an actual world simulator with fifty billion digital folks all interacting actual time together with your actions having a butterfly impact on the way forward for the digital universe when its simply your first sport. Actually. Many individuals attempt it; none that I do know of have succeeded. Imitation is one of the best ways to start out out. Easy video games equivalent to Area Invaders, Tetris, Pacman and even Pong are nice locations to start out. All are largely easy to create however have some inherent challenges. Pacman for instance, requires path discovering for the ghosts. I like to recommend that you simply begin even less complicated than that in your very first try. Area Invaders is a pleasant level to leap in. You may make a easy, full sport with out a lot effort and its nearly infinitely extensible.
When youre caught for an thought, choose a style that you simply get pleasure from. Do you like journey video games equivalent to Monkey Island, Grim Fandango, Area Quest, Kings Quest and so on.? Design a kind of. Are you into preventing video games like Avenue Fighter, Tekken, Soul Calibur, Mortal Kombat and so forth? Provide you with an thought for that. Do you want first individual shooters equivalent to Quake, Half Life or Doom? I dont suggest it as a primary mission, however you may at all times give it a go. Be happy to be as generic as you want, this can be a studying expertise in any case.
Now that you've your thought its time to flesh it out. Dont fear in regards to the know-how or the truth that you could not know learn how to truly implement a sport simply but, simply seize your self some paper and a pencil and go loopy with concepts. Describe the primary characters, sport play, objectives, interactions, story, and key mappings, something you may consider. Ensure you have sufficient element so that somebody can learn by way of the notes and play by way of the sport of their head with relative accuracy. Altering sport design through the coding course of is sort of at all times a foul thought. As soon as its set, it ought to stay set till the tweaking section (Ill go into this extra later) otherwise youre more likely to enter growth hell, the place the mission goes on and on; increasingly more work is completed with much less and fewer final result.
On the finish of this era of your sport creation, you must have the next:
– A written define of the sports characters and presumably a sketch or two (be they house ships, yellow circles, automobiles or the prince of the darkish kingdom of Falgour, it's essential to know who or what the participant will likely be and who they may compete towards)
– A written define of the story (if there's one, this isnt too important for Area Invaders or Tetris, however for Uber Quest: An Journey of Awesomeness its a very good thought)
– An outline of sport play, written or storyboarded. Storyboards are visible representations of concepts. Draw your characters in actions, with arrows displaying the circulation of motion and brief written descriptions detailing the occasions occurring in your picture (as a result of a few of us arent implausible artists and our photographs could be a little open to interpretation )
Now that you've a fleshed out thought, its time to work out how this can all get put collectively. When youve gotten so far and are nervous that you simplyre going to need to spend years studying complicated programming languages in an effort to implement your thought, concern not! Others have already finished the exhausting yards for you. There are lots of RAD (Speedy Utility Improvement) Instruments out there for sport creation, a lot of which can be found without spending a dime on-line. A few of them nonetheless require you to be taught a scripting language (a simplified programming language made for a selected process) however normally this isnt too difficult or concerned. Ive compiled a short checklist of a few of these I've discovered on the finish of the article. The free ones are listed first, organized by sport style.
Nicely, that needs to be sufficient to get you began within the creation of your sport. Crucial factor to recollect when youve gotten this far is that it's essential to full your sport. Many individuals begin a mission after which lose curiosity and it fails, or they hold shifting on to 1 new mission after one other with out ending something. Begin small, construct a working (if easy) sport that's, above all else, full. Once you get to this stage you'll at all times have an enormous variety of issues that you simply want to change, repair and so on. however youll get an awesome feeling from figuring out that it's, in its means, completed.
From this level, you can begin the tweaking section. Play your sport a number of instances and ask others to do the identical. Be aware of what isnt enjoyable or may very well be higher and alter issues right here. At this stage, it's extra necessary than ever to maintain backups of earlier variations in order that if a change doesnt work you may return and take a look at one thing completely different with out shedding any of your work. It's at this level which you could add all new options, enhance graphics and sounds, no matter you please, secure within the data that you simplyre engaged on a strong basis.
Once youre completely satisfied together with your sport, why not share it with the world? There are lots of low-cost or free locations on the market so that you can host your recordsdata on after which you may bounce on hyperlink lists and boards and let everybody find out about your creation. Nicely, I hope that this has been a useful introduction into the artwork of making video games. Its a substantial amount of enjoyable, and may open entire new avenues of artistic expression so that you can discover. Soar in and have enjoyable!
Journey Video games:
(Video games equivalent to Monkey Island, Kings Quest, Area Quest and so on.)
Journey Sport Studio: [http://www.bigbluecup.com]
3D Journey Studio: http://3das.noeska.com/
ADRIFT (for textual content adventures): http://www.adrift.org.uk/
Position Taking part in Video games (RPGs):
(Video games equivalent to Closing Fantasy, Breath of Hearth, Diablo)
RPG Toolit: http://www.toolkitzone.com/
Combating Video games:
(Video games equivalent to Avenue Fighter, Mortal Kombat, Tekken, Soul Calibur and so on.)
MUGEN (sadly the positioning is essentially in French): http://www.streetmugen.com/mugen-us.html
Aspect-Scrolling Video games:
(Video games such because the 2D Mario Video games, Sonic the Hedgehog, Double Dragon and so on.)
The Scrolling Sport Improvement Package: http://gamedev.sourceforge.web/
There are lots of others out there as effectively. One notably helpful website for locating sport creation instruments is: http://www.ambrosine.com/useful resource.html
Additionally of observe, though not freeware, are the superb sport creation instruments out there by Clickteam at: [http://www.clickteam.com/English/]
Klik and Play and The Video games Manufacturing unit particularly are the packages to take a look at and obtain the free demos of.
When you actually need to do issues proper and program the sport your self, there are some glorious programming assets out there on the following places:
Visible Primary Sport Programming:
#Create #Pc #Video games #Began #Creating #Digital #Worlds
Create Pc Video games – Get Began on Creating Your Personal Digital Worlds